Read moreArizona is well-known for its stunning desert landscapes and vibrant cities, but when it comes to oceanfront properties, it might surprise many to learn that Arizona is a landlocked state with no direct access to the ocean. However, the concept of "oceanfront property in AZ" could refer to waterfront properties near large lakes or man-made coastal environments that mimic oceanfront living. In my personal experience exploring real estate options in Arizona, places like Lake Havasu City offer waterfront properties that provide a beach-like atmosphere right in the desert. The proximity to iconic routes such as Route 66 adds cultural richness and recreational opportunities, making these properties highly valued for both vacation homes and investment purposes. If you are considering this kind of niche real estate, it’s essential to understand the distinction between traditional oceanfront (seaside) properties and lakefront or riverfront properties in Arizona. Properties adjacent to bodies of water like Lake Powell or Lake Mead offer boating, fishing, and watersports akin to coastal living but without the ocean. From a practical standpoint, investing in waterfront property in Arizona comes with considerations such as water rights, seasonal climate variations, and local tourism trends. These factors affect property value and rental potential. Overall, turning to Arizona’s waterfront properties near famous highways and recreational lakes opens a unique lifestyle choice combining desert beauty, road trip culture, and waterfront leisure, making it a compelling option for those seeking something different from conventional beachside living.
